President Trump has to stop live speech as he rushed from podium after ‘medical emergency’

President Donald Trump was compelled to shorten his remarks during a press conference on Friday, which White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t abruptly ended.

Dr. Mehmet Oz, a television personality who was appointed to head the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) during Trump’s second term, was sworn in at the same time as the event.

The broadcast abruptly stopped as the briefing was coming to an end, and the screen went black. FOX News reports that one of Dr. Oz’s children had to be escorted out of the Oval Office due to a medical emergency, which caused the press conference to end early.

According to Mirror US, Dr. Oz’s wife Lisa looked clearly worried, and President Trump briefly left the podium to consider the situation. The scene became even more chaotic as Dr. Oz hurried over to help.

The presenter on FOX News said, “The press is being escorted out of the room, so we don’t know what’s going on there.” Naturally, it is evident that a situation could have arisen, possibly involving medical issues.

 

 

 

Another video later revealed a young girl being helped as she was led out of the Oval Office. The White House has not yet issued an official statement on the incident.
